Complete: Joe wouldn't have crashed if ... a) he hadn't been driving so fast. b) he hadn't drove so fast. My textbook says the suitable form is letter a. Can't figure out why.Could anybody tell me if they mean the same? =)NOTE: Consider "hadn't driven" not "hadn't drove". My mistake.

As Mikey says, b) is incorrect anyway because the past participle of 'drive' is 'driven', not 'drove'. a) is correct because the continuous form is needed. The action 'crashed' interrupts the continuous action that was in progress at the time 'driving'.
